Key facts about BRL and ETB

  • About the Brazilian real

    Name:
    Brazilian real
    Symbol:
    R$
    Minor unit:
    1/100 Centavo
    Central Bank:
    Banco Central Do Brasil
    Country:
    Brazil
    Rank in the most traded currencies:
    #19
  • About the Ethiopian birr

    Name:
    Ethiopian birr
    Symbol:
    Br
    Minor unit:
    1/100 Santim
    Central Bank:
    National Bank of Ethiopia
    Country:
    Ethiopia
